one of my problems that i posted about alittle while ago, well i finally figured it out today. both the upper ball joints are bad. there is just a little bit of play in them. so heres my new questions. how soon should i change them? i dont have a lot of money. what are some risks of driving on them for say a month? (i put about 70 miles on my car aday)and if i have to do them really soon, how hard are they to change? will i have to remove the coil spring and shock? or can they be changed with them still in there? any help is greatly appriaciated. Changing them is not too bad. You have to replace the whole a-arm and getting to the bolt that is on the drivers side rear fender well that holds the trailing arm can be a real pita. The arms run in the neighborhood of $100 a side and a good alignment should be done after they're replaced. It only takes about 30 minutes a side. You have to jack up the car, remove the tire and rim, remove the 2 bolts that hold the arms to the fender wells and remove the nut that holds the ball joint to the spindle assembly. It's good to have a big hammer to get the joint out of the spindle. Worst case scenario from having a ball joint fail completely is loss of steering control, and the car will fall onto the tire and cause damage the fender.
